The Alcohol Footbridge in Porto Seguro is a popular pedestrian bridge that spans across the Buranhém River. It is a well-known landmark in the city and is often visited by tourists who want to take in the beautiful views of the river and the surrounding areas. The bridge is made of wood and has a rustic feel to it, which adds to its charm.
The Alcohol Footbridge is located in the heart of Porto Seguro and is easily accessible from the city center. It is a great place to take a leisurely stroll and enjoy the sights and sounds of the river. The bridge is also a popular spot for fishing, as the river is home to a variety of fish species.
One of the most unique features of the Alcohol Footbridge is the colorful murals that adorn its walls. These murals depict scenes from the history of Porto Seguro and are a great way to learn about the city's past. The bridge is also home to a number of street vendors who sell souvenirs and local handicrafts.
At night, the Alcohol Footbridge is lit up with colorful lights, which creates a magical atmosphere. It is a great place to take a romantic stroll with a loved one or to simply relax and enjoy the peaceful surroundings.
